Walkers, Bicyclists Take Center Stage at May 2 Meeting

CULPEPER – Bicyclists and walkers will have an opportunity to hear about the Virginia Department of Transportation’s bicycle and pedestrian program during a meeting on Wednesday, May 2 in Culpeper.

VDOT’s program was conceived to ensure that bicycling, walking and other forms of non-motorized transportation receive the same consideration as motorized transportation in the planning, design, construction and operation of Virginia’s transportation network. The program also stresses the criticality of ensuring that the disabled community has access to the facilities, that the bicycle and pedestrian facilities provide connectivity with other modes of transportation and allow independent mobility regardless of age, physical constraints or income.

The meeting in Culpeper is being organized in cooperation with the Rappahannock-Rapidan Regional Commission. It will be held at 4 p.m. in the auditorium of VDOT’s Culpeper District Headquarters, 1601 Orange Road in Culpeper.

It is planned to reach local officials and staff, the advisory committees that participate in transportation planning in the area served by the planning district, bicycle and pedestrian advocates and interested members of the public. The Rappahannock-Rapidan Regional Commission serves Culpeper, Fauquier, Madison, Orange and Rappahannock counties and the towns of Culpeper, Gordonsville, Madison, Orange, Remington, and Warrenton.

Officials from VDOT’s planning and land development staff will talk about the agency’s program. Following those presentations there will be ample opportunity for questions and informal discussion of the program and how it can be integrated into local and regional transportation planning.
